S4102-01 LB&SCR K Class 2-6-0 LBSC Black No.341 Red Lining Steam Locomotive Brand_Wrenn Building commenced in January 1962Available Exclusively from Rails of Sheffield Please Note: LB&SCR K Class will now include red lining and be numbered 341 rather than the previously described unlined and numbered 346 History The LBSCR Engineer Lawson Billinton in 1912 designed a new powerful goods locomotive that coped with heavy loads at speed.
